i installed one a few weeks ago, so far so good. make sure you do the bypass or have them do it.
although i heard the navigation wasnt to good, it has been spot on the 3 times i used it.
only thing i hate about it is the single slot dvd which means no cd music when using the navigation unless you have an ipod.

i had the unit installed saturday. the navigation is very intuitive, and seems to be on point. while you do need to switch Cd's and navi disks in order to utilize the navi, i think the D3 is the best value for the price.
i cant find any issues with it. the gauges that show accelleration, lateral G's, etc. are pretty fun to screw around with.

i can take pictures soon, and post them. however, as you may know - it is "doubledin" which means that it fits rather perfectly into the SC300/400 stock nakimichi system's place. There is about 1/3 cm on either side of the unit, and about 1 inch below that you could easily fill with a custom cut piece of plastic molding. other than that 1 inch gap (easy to fill), it fits perfectly!

i have one for about a month now and so far so good. the only thing annoying for me is that the navi operates by memory so when you're driving when playing music and you drive into area that aren't in the navi's memory, you then a get a useless map. load times are pretty quick, but changing cds for navi is quite a hassle. make sure you get them to hook up the nighttime setting because it doesn't come automatically, or can be set up manually. the look of this player once installed is amazing, i didn't even know that this is an aftermaket player, looks much better and cleaner than the motorized double dins. all in all, this a a super good player, the navi is good while still affordable. kenwood wanted me to spend another 1000 on top of the player for a navi system that isn't up to par.
